【摘要】1第3章動態(tài)規(guī)劃2學習要點:?理解動態(tài)規(guī)劃算法的概念。?掌握動態(tài)規(guī)劃算法的基本要素?(1)最優(yōu)子結(jié)構(gòu)性質(zhì)?(2)重疊子問題性質(zhì)?掌握設(shè)計動態(tài)規(guī)劃算法的步驟。?(1)找出最優(yōu)解的性質(zhì),并刻劃其結(jié)構(gòu)特征。?(2)遞歸地定義最優(yōu)值。?(3)以自底向上的方式計算出最優(yōu)值。?
2025-05-21 12:09
【摘要】第八章動態(tài)規(guī)劃問題及求解8.1多階段決策問題動態(tài)規(guī)劃是解決這樣一類最優(yōu)化問題的專門計算方法,這類問題允許把它的過程(求解)分解為一系列的單級過程(步驟)。最優(yōu)化原理:達到系統(tǒng)某種狀態(tài)的過程無論是怎樣的,以這個狀態(tài)為初始狀態(tài)的剩余過程的求解仍是最優(yōu)的規(guī)劃。也就是說,當系統(tǒng)處于第i個狀態(tài)時,只要最優(yōu)規(guī)劃剩余的in?個過程,便
2025-05-21 00:31
【摘要】第二節(jié)動態(tài)規(guī)劃應(yīng)用舉例本節(jié)將通過動態(tài)規(guī)劃的三種應(yīng)用類型——資源分配問題、復(fù)合系統(tǒng)可靠性問題、設(shè)備更新問題,進一步介紹動態(tài)規(guī)劃的特點和處理方法。一、資源分配問題1.問題的一般提法設(shè)有某種資源,總數(shù)量為a,用于生產(chǎn)n種
2025-05-21 12:08
【摘要】背包類動態(tài)規(guī)劃問題長沙市雅禮中學朱全民經(jīng)典的背包問題(01背包)?有N件物品;?第i件物品Wi公斤;?第i件物品價值Ci元;?現(xiàn)有一輛載重M公斤的卡車;?問選取裝載哪些物品,使得卡車運送的總價值最大?搜索法?對于每種物品,要么裝上卡車,要么不裝,因此,N種物品的裝箱方案共
2025-05-18 18:27
【摘要】1背包類動態(tài)規(guī)劃問題2經(jīng)典的背包問題(01背包)?有N件物品;?第i件物品Wi公斤;?第i件物品價值Ci元;?現(xiàn)有一輛載重M公斤的卡車;?問選取裝載哪些物品,使得卡車運送的總價值最大?3動態(tài)規(guī)劃?可以按每個物品進行規(guī)劃,同樣每種物品有選和不選兩種選擇?設(shè)F(i,j)表示前i件
【摘要】區(qū)間類動態(tài)規(guī)劃合并類動態(tài)規(guī)劃的特點?合并:意思就是將兩個或多個部分進行整合,當然也可以反過來,也就是是將一個問題進行分解成兩個或多個部分。?特征:能將問題分解成為兩兩合并的形式?求解:對整個問題設(shè)最優(yōu)值,枚舉合并點,將問題分解成為左右兩個部分,最后將左右兩個部分的最優(yōu)值進行合并得到原問題的最優(yōu)值。有點類似分治算法的解題思想。
2025-05-21 12:39
【摘要】第四章動態(tài)規(guī)劃動態(tài)規(guī)劃動態(tài)規(guī)劃是解決多階段決策過程最優(yōu)化問題的一種方法。在二十世紀五十年代由美國數(shù)學家理查德.貝爾曼(Richard.Ba11man)首先提出的。它可以把一個n維最優(yōu)化問題轉(zhuǎn)化為n個一維最優(yōu)化問題來求解。一個決策問題,往往可以分解成若干個相互聯(lián)系,又相對獨立的階段,對于每一個階段,
【摘要】6/3/20221§6動態(tài)規(guī)劃模型舉例6/3/20222以上討論的優(yōu)化問題大多數(shù)屬于靜態(tài)的,即不必考慮時間的變化,建立的模型——線性規(guī)劃、非線性規(guī)劃、整數(shù)規(guī)劃等,都屬于靜態(tài)規(guī)劃。多階段決策屬于動態(tài)優(yōu)化問題,即在每個階段(通常以時間或空間為標志)要根據(jù)過程的演變情況確定一個決策,使全過程的某個指標達到最優(yōu)。例如:
【摘要】NOIP基礎(chǔ)算法綜合巴蜀中學黃新軍第一節(jié)枚舉算法一、枚舉法的基本思想?枚舉法的基本思想:根據(jù)實際問題設(shè)計多重循環(huán),一一枚舉所有可能的狀態(tài),并用問題給定的約束條件檢驗?zāi)男顟B(tài)是需要的,哪些狀態(tài)是不需要的。能使命題成立的狀態(tài),即為其解。雖然枚舉法本質(zhì)上屬于搜索策略,但是它與后面講的回溯法或?qū)挾葍?yōu)先搜索有所不同。二、
2025-05-20 18:15
【摘要】NOIP圖的常用算法簡介石門中學江濤目錄?圖的表示鄰接矩陣、鄰接鏈表、圖的遍歷?最小生成樹算法Prim算法、Kruskal算法?最短路徑算法Dijkstra算法、Bellman_Ford算法及SPFA算法、Floyd算法
【摘要】第1頁共64頁第四章動態(tài)規(guī)劃——DynamicProgramming(DP)動態(tài)規(guī)劃是運籌學的一個重要分支,是解決多階段決策過程最優(yōu)化問題的一種非常有效的方法。1951年,美國數(shù)學家貝爾曼()等人,根據(jù)一類多階段決策問題的特點,把多階段決策問題變換為一系列相互聯(lián)系的單階段決策問題,然后分階段逐個加以解決。
2025-05-18 18:35
【摘要】ACM程序設(shè)計謝勇2022/6/22今天,你AC嗎?2022/6/23第四講動態(tài)規(guī)劃入門(Dynamicprogramming)2022/6/24一、經(jīng)典問題:數(shù)塔問題有形如下圖所示的數(shù)塔,從頂部出發(fā),在每一結(jié)點可以選擇向左走或是向右走,一直走到底
2025-05-20 07:49
【摘要】EXCEL教程難得的excel教程集珍藏版,簡單明了,包你學會。?自動篩選?在Excel中字符替換?在Excel中直接編輯“宏”?在Excel中為導入外部數(shù)據(jù)?在Excel中行列快速轉(zhuǎn)換?在Excel中運行“宏”?在Excel中添加說明文字?在Excel中數(shù)據(jù)分列整理?在E
2024-08-30 12:46
【摘要】初賽知識復(fù)習2021/10/11初賽試題形式●初賽:初賽全部為筆試,滿分100分。試題由四部分組成:1、選擇題:共20題,每題,共計30分。每題有5個備選答案,前10個題為單選題(即每題有且只有一個正確答案,選對得分),后10題為不定項選擇題(即每題有1至5個正確答案,只有全部選對才得分)。
2025-01-30 11:37
【摘要】動態(tài)規(guī)劃經(jīng)典教程引言:本人在做過一些題目后對DP有些感想,就寫了這個總結(jié):第一節(jié)動態(tài)規(guī)劃基本概念一,動態(tài)規(guī)劃三要素:階段,狀態(tài),決策。他們的概念到處都是,我就不多說了,我只說說我對他們的理解:如果把動態(tài)規(guī)劃的求解過程看成一個工廠的生產(chǎn)線,階段就是生產(chǎn)某個商品的不同的環(huán)節(jié),狀態(tài)就是工件當前的形態(tài),決策就是對工件的操作。顯然不同階段是對產(chǎn)品的一個前面各個狀態(tài)的小結(jié),有一個個的小
2024-08-23 14:27